Anyone else running the TS test pipes?

dont waste your money on this exhaust I have it and have had problems from the moment I bought the exhaust it came all scratched up with dents looked like it was used they used barely any bubble wrap for shipping. Drivers side flex pipe came broken so I had to replace that. Resonators blew after having them on for a month with less than 1200 miles on the exhaust, so I had to replace those as well. With the money I've spent fixing the mistakes from factory I could have got a Fast Intentions exhaust. I bought the resonated test pipes from fast intentions and the craftsmanship was amazing compared to top speed and they were used. I'm saving up now for another exhaust probably the fast intentions hopefully nothing else goes wrong with this exhaust before I get my next one :ugh2:

Anyone else running the TS test pipes?

I have the TS Test pipes on a base stock setup. A lilttle raspy. More than I would like. Really noticable around the 2500-2700 RPM range. I have had them for almost a month now, but have hardly driven the Z since I was on vacation. Really only done about 1 weeks worth of driving since installed. Rasp has gone down some and hoping it continues to go down with more driving on it. Got mine for $125 shipped off ebay. Can't really complain for that price.

edub370 01-03-2013 08:21 AM

thats the stock exhaust + test pipes. it wasn't a pleasant combo on my car either. get a cat back and it will help that rasp go away
